Description
Appreciate how and why city roads are changing to accommodate active travel, such as walking and cycling
Identify the most vulnerable road users and how they interact with traffic
Understand how to share the road safely with others through applying defensive driving techniques
Be aware of the use and limitations of supplementary vehicle safety equipment and how to maintain its effectiveness
Gain first-hand experience of being a vulnerable road user, through Virtual Reality hazard awareness, and recognise why cyclists behave the way they do
